    'The Sun newspaper’s decision to print nude pictures of Prince Harry against the wishes of the Royal Family sends a message that it will fight tougher media regulation in the wake of Britain’s phone-hacking scandal.

    Thursday’s papers refrained from running the grainy snaps showing the third in line to the throne cavorting naked with friends in a Las Vegas hotel suite after royal officials contacted the Press Complaints Commission media watchdog.
